大数据架构师编程核心:语言选择与变量优化策略
|
大数据架构师在设计系统时,语言选择是至关重要的第一步。不同的编程语言在性能、生态支持和适用场景上各有特点。例如,Java 和 Scala 适合构建高并发、分布式系统,而 Python 则在数据处理和机器学习方面表现出色。 选择合适的语言可以显著提升系统的效率和可维护性。比如,在实时数据处理中,Go 语言的轻量级和高效并发模型使其成为优选。而在复杂的数据分析任务中,R 或 Python 提供了丰富的库和工具链,能够快速实现算法原型。 变量优化策略同样不可忽视。合理的变量命名和作用域管理可以减少内存占用,提高代码可读性。避免使用全局变量,尽量将变量限制在最小的作用域内,有助于降低耦合度。
此示意图由AI提供,仅供参考 变量类型的选择也影响性能。在静态类型语言中,明确的类型声明可以帮助编译器进行更高效的优化。而在动态类型语言中,合理使用类型提示或类型检查工具也能提升运行效率。数据结构的选择与变量优化密切相关。使用合适的数据结构可以减少不必要的计算和存储开销。例如,哈希表适合快速查找,而数组则更适合顺序访问。 持续监控和调优是确保系统稳定运行的关键。通过性能分析工具,可以发现变量使用中的瓶颈,并针对性地进行优化。 (编辑:应用网_阳江站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102331048号